PNG
JPG
BMP
TIFF
PDF
Fusionner des PDF dans le SDK .NET
Fusionnez deux fichiers PDF en un seul dans l’API Cloud C# sans utiliser de logiciel comme Adobe PDF.
Get StartedComment fusionner plusieurs fichiers PDF en utilisant l'API Cloud C#
Pour fusionner deux fichiers PDF, nous utiliserons Aspose.PDF Cloud .NET SDK Ce SDK Cloud vous permet de créer facilement des applications basées sur le cloud pour créateur, éditeur et convertisseur de PDF en C#, ASP.NET ou d’autres langues .NET pour différentes plateformes cloud. Ouvrez NuGet le gestionnaire de packages, recherchez Aspose.PDF Cloud et installez-le. Vous pouvez également utiliser la commande suivante depuis la console du gestionnaire de packages.
Commande
PM> Install-Package Aspose.Pdf-Cloud
Étape de fusion de PDF via Cloud .NET SDK
Une fusion de base de PDFs de manière programmmatique avec Aspose.PDF Cloud .NET SDK APIs peut être fait avec seulement quelques lignes de code.
- Créez un nouvel objet Configuration avec votre Clé d’application et Secrète
- Créez un objet pour vous connecter à l’API Cloud
- Téléchargez votre fichier de document
- Effectuez la fusion
- Téléchargez le résultat
Fusionner deux fichiers PDF en utilisant C#
internal static void MergePdf()
{
const string localImageFileName = @"C:\Samples\sample.pdf";
const string storageFileName1 = "sample1.pdf";
const string storageFileName2 = "sample2.pdf";
const string resultFileName = "merged-doc.pdf";
// Get your AppSid and AppSecret https://dashboard.aspose.cloud (free registration required).
var pdfApi = new PdfApi(AppSecret, AppSid);
using var file = File.OpenRead(localImageFileName);
pdfApi.UploadFile(storageFileName1, file);
pdfApi.CopyFile(storageFileName1, storageFileName2);
var documentsToBeMerged = new List<string>()
{
storageFileName1, storageFileName2
};
var documents = new Aspose.Pdf.Cloud.Sdk.Model.MergeDocuments(documentsToBeMerged);
pdfApi.PutMergeDocuments(resultFileName, documents);
var response = pdfApi.DownloadFile(resultFileName);
response.CopyTo(File.OpenWrite(resultFileName));
Console.WriteLine();
}